Description

This comprehensive book is designed for anyone looking to advance their electrophysiology knowledge including nurse practitioners, EP nurses and technologists, and new EP fellows. It begins by covering cardiac anatomy including a thorough heart dissection, the conduction system, and ECG rhythm interpretation. Next, is an introduction to the EP lab, x-ray imaging, electrograms, and pacing protocols. This is followed by a detailed explanation of cardiac arrhythmias and treatment strategies. To complete your understanding, the book covers cardiac ablation, intracardiac echo, and antiarrhythmic medications. This is ideal for anyone preparing for the RCES or IBHRE (CEPS). This book is best when paired with the corresponding workbook (Understanding EP: Workbook) to assess your knowledge while practicing interpretation skills.
